I ran into an issue last night when setting up Windows 7 on my T420. Everything was going great until I installed the power management (ACPI) drivers. Then all the sudden I started getting bluescreens about every 5 minutes.
Unfortunately I'd been installing a lot of drivers so I didn't realize it was the power management drivers right away. After troubleshooting for a while I found out it was an issue with ACPI and the firmware on the Crucial M4 SSD.
Fortunately on 6/13/2011 Crucial had posted an updated firmware for the m4 drive (Firmware: 0002) that fixed an issue with "Link Power Management ("LPM")". After updating the firmware I haven't had any bluescreens yet. Granted I haven't spent a lot of time on it. However considering it was bluescreening every 5 minutes most of the evening and hasn't this morning with 2 hour usage I'd say that was the issue.
I just wanted to post this as a heads up for anyone using Windows 7 who puts a Crucial m4 SSD in their system. Eventually newer m4 drives coming off the shelf will have the new firmware on it and it won't be an issue.
